Fireman’s street dance slated for Oct. 31
Staff Report
Published October 27, 2009
A United Firemans’ Street Dance will be held beginning at 5 p.m. Saturday, Oct. 31 in Blossom. The event is scheduled at the intersection of Front and Center Streets between the Blossom Hardware Store and the Blossom Machine Shop.
The dance is sponsored by the Blossom, Deport, East Post Oak, Faught and Reno volunteer fire departments.
There will be an open stage and bands are welcome with karaoke during breaks and band down time. Food will be provided with adult plates $5 each, including brisket, potato salad, beans and tea. Children’s plates will consist of hot dogs and nachos, and children under 6 eat free.
“This event is a public thank you for all the support,” said Heath Thomas of Blossom VFD. “It is only with your support that we as volunteer fire departments can continue to provide service, and we would like to extend a well deserved thank you to all of you,”
The event will include games and activities for children, and trick-or-treat bags will be provided. There will also be a costume contest with prizes for first, second and third place, as determined by a panel of judges.
